Concrete slab services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of flat concrete surfaces that serve as foundations or flooring for various properties. These services typically include preparing the site, pouring the concrete, and finishing the surface to ensure durability and levelness. Whether it's a new driveway, a garage floor, or a patio, experienced contractors can handle the entire process to create a stable and long-lasting surface. Properly installed concrete slabs provide a solid base that supports the structure above and helps prevent future issues related to uneven settling or cracking.

One common problem that concrete slab services address is cracking or uneven surfaces caused by soil movement, poor initial installation, or exposure to the elements. Over time, concrete can develop cracks, become uneven, or suffer from surface deterioration, which can compromise safety and functionality. Repair work often involves removing damaged sections, filling cracks, or replacing entire slabs to restore stability. Additionally, service providers can reinforce existing slabs with additional support or apply protective coatings to extend their lifespan and improve resistance to weather-related wear.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Slab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Columbia, MO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s range from $250 to $600 for minor patching or crack repairs on residential concrete slabs.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and area size.

New Concrete Slabs - installing a new concrete slab generally costs between $1,200 and $3,500 for standard projects. Larger or more complex installations can reach $5,000 or more, though most projects stay within the lower to mid-range.

Full Replacement - replacing an existing concrete slab usually costs between $3,000 and $8,000, depending on size, thickness, and site conditions. Many full replacements fall into the mid to higher end of this range, with fewer projects exceeding $8,000.

Commercial Projects - large-scale commercial concrete work can vary widely, typically from $10,000 to over $50,000 for extensive slabs or industrial sites. These costs depend heavily on project scope, with most jobs in the lower to mid-tier of this spectrum.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ete slab services are available in Columbia, MO? Local contractors offer a range of services including residential and commercial slab installation, repair, leveling, and finishing to meet various project needs.

How do contractors prepare for a concrete slab project? Service providers typically assess the site, prepare the ground, set forms, and ensure proper reinforcement before pouring concrete to ensure a durable result.

Can local contractors handle custom or decorative concrete slabs? Yes, many service providers in the area offer decorative finishes, stamping, staining, and custom designs to enhance the appearance of concrete slabs.

What factors influence the quality of a concrete slab installation? Proper site preparation, quality materials, correct reinforcement, and skilled workmanship are key factors that impact the durability and appearance of the slab.
